1. Understanding Post-Boost Exercise:

Post-boost exercise refers to engaging in physical activity after consuming a supplement designed to enhance athletic performance and recovery. This practice aims to capitalize on the supplement's benefits while engaging in targeted workouts to stimulate muscle growth and improve overall fitness.

2. The Benefits of Post-Boost Exercise:

a. Enhanced Recovery: Supplements, such as protein powders, BCAAs (branched-chain amino acids), and creatine, provide essential nutrients to support muscle repair and recovery after intense exercise. Post-boost exercise helps accelerate this process by promoting blood flow and oxygen delivery to the muscles, aiding in the removal of metabolic waste products.

b. Increased Strength: By incorporating post-boost exercise, individuals can maximize the effectiveness of their workouts. The supplement's ingredients, such as caffeine and beta-alanine, can enhance mental focus, energy levels, and muscle endurance, enabling individuals to push their limits and build strength more efficiently.

c. Improved Performance: Post-boost exercise allows athletes to train at higher intensities and for longer durations, leading to improved performance in various sports and fitness activities. The enhanced recovery and increased strength gained from the supplement help maintain peak performance levels throughout the training process.

3. The Ideal Post-Boost Exercise Routine:

a. Timing: It is crucial to time the post-boost exercise correctly to maximize the benefits. Ideally, engage in physical activity within 30 minutes to an hour after consuming the supplement. This timeframe allows the body to absorb the nutrients effectively and utilize them during exercise.

b. Exercise Intensity: The intensity of the workout should be moderate to high, depending on the individual's fitness level and goals. High-intensity interval training (HIIT) or strength training exercises are excellent choices for post-boost exercise, as they provide the necessary stress on the muscles to elicit growth and improvement.

c. Duration: The duration of the workout should be around 45-60 minutes, ensuring that the body can fully utilize the supplement's benefits without overexerting itself. It is important to maintain a balance between intensity and duration to prevent fatigue and injury.
